Emir of Ilorin Sympathizes with Bode Saadu Residents Affected by Flooding

Date: 2024-09-20

News from Royal News highlights that the Emir of Ilorin and Chairman of the Kwara State Traditional Rulers Council, Mai-Martaba Alhaji (Dr)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ari CFR, has expressed his sympathy to the residents of Bode Saadu in Moro Local Government Area following the flooding that affected many households.

In a statement issued on Thursday by his spokesman, Mallam Abdulazeez Arowona, Alhaji Sulu-Gambari described the flooding incident as unfortunate and extended his heartfelt concern to the affected families.

He sympathised with the affected victims over the loss of property and dislodgement from their respective homes saying: “I received the news of the incidence with worries and discomfort. My heart and prayers are with you at this crucial period.”

The Emir however thanked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q for his prompt response and visit to the scene of disaster even as he appealed for adequate support for the affected families.

Alhaji Sulu-Gambari therefore urged religion leaders in Ilorin Emirate and beyond to be more prayerful to Almighty Allah for maximum protection against calamities and disasters in Kwara State and Nigeria at large.
